For those considering similar procedures, it’s essential to understand the realities of rhinoplasty. The surgery typically takes 1-2 hours under general anesthesia and involves reshaping the bone and cartilage. Recovery can take up to 6 weeks, with visible bruising and swelling in the first 2 weeks. Costs range from $5,000 to $15,000, depending on the surgeon’s expertise and location. Lip fillers, typically composed of hyaluronic acid, are injected in small doses (0.5–1 ml per session) to avoid an overdone look. For someone like Tomlinson, who maintains a natural appearance, a conservative approach would be essential. Practitioners often recommend starting with 0.5 ml for first-timers, followed by touch-ups every 6–12 months to maintain results. If he did opt for fillers, this method would explain the subtle enhancement without drastic alteration.

For those considering lip fillers inspired by such trends, caution is paramount. Choose a qualified, experienced injector to minimize risks like bruising, swelling, or asymmetry. Post-procedure care includes avoiding strenuous activity for 24 hours and applying ice to reduce swelling. Costs vary widely, ranging from $500 to $2,000 per session, depending on location and provider. While the procedure is minimally invasive, results are temporary, lasting 6–18 months, making it a commitment to upkeep rather than a one-time fix.

This procedure, commonly known as eyelid surgery, removes excess skin, fat, and muscle to create a more open, youthful look. From a practical standpoint, anyone considering eyelid surgery should weigh the risks and benefits. The procedure typically takes 1–3 hours under local anesthesia with sedation, and recovery spans 1–2 weeks. Common side effects include swelling, bruising, and temporary dryness. For public figures like Tomlinson, such changes are scrutinized, but for individuals, the decision should prioritize personal satisfaction over external opinions. Always consult a board-certified surgeon to discuss expectations and potential outcomes.
